Scrumptious and Nutritious Banana Chocolate Chip Muffins |
|
 |
Prep Time: 10 Minutes Cook Time: 34 Minutes |
Ready In: 44 Minutes Servings: 4 |
|
I've been told I should open a bakery with these muffins. They are moist, flavorful, low fat, and low calorie. If you're like me and feel guilty eating 3 or 4 cookies in a sitting, these muffins are the answer! Ingredients:
2 cups white wheat flour |
1 cup quick-cooking oats |
3/4 cup brown sugar |
1/2 cup white sugar |
1 teaspoon baking soda |
1 teaspoon baking powder |
1 teaspoon salt |
2 large eggs, using egg whites only |
1/3 cup sugar free applesauce |
1 cup skim milk or 1 cup almond milk |
1 teaspoon vanilla extract |
2 ripe bananas, mashed |
1/2 bag mini semi dark chocolate chips |
1/2 cup walnuts (optional) or 1/2 cup almonds (optional) |
Directions:
1. Preheat oven to 375. Prepare muffin tins with paper liners or grease with non stick spray. In a medium bowl mix together dry ingredients. This includes flour, oats, sugars, baking soda, baking powder, chocolate, nuts, and salt until well blended. In a separate larger bowl blend applesauce, eggs, milk, and vanilla with a whisk. Add in bananas and stir until an even texture is achieved. Mix dry ingredients in with wet mixture just until moistened. I like to fold the mixture together. Fill mini or regular sized muffin tins just over half full. Bake for 14 to 18 minutes until toothpick comes out clean. Enjoy! |
